Issues Setting up APX320 Access Points

Hello,

I am new to the world of Sophos and especially the access point aspect. I was under the impression that these were more or less plug and play and that has not been my experience. I think my setup is atypical and that is causing the issues. My DHCP is not my Sophos firewall it is a server that is on our network and my default gateway is the switch stack commander (stack of HP Procurve switches). I am seeing that these reach out to the default gateway with the IP address of 1.2.3.4 which again is the stack. I also saw that I can add a predefined option to the DHCP server with 234 and the IP address of the Sophos Firewall. I tried this and didn't have any luck either. What can I do get these points to talk to the firewall. Sorry if this isn't all the information needed but again, I am new to all of this.
